In this you will be supporting a Senior Leader, providing reciprocal cover for your fellow colleagues or deputise for the Senior Executive Assistant.
Responsibilities of a Personal Assistant- Gathering and collating information and distributing reports, key performance indicators and statistical information
- Responsibility for screening and management of calls
- Responsibility for diary and travel management ensuring that time is managed effectively
- Administering the inbox of your senior lead(s) taking action, redistributing and/or liaising as appropriate
- Supporting the reclaiming of out of pocket business expenses and assistance with credit card reconciliation
- Planning and organising business events as required such as colleague conferences, award ceremonies, meetings and away days
- Deadline management to ensure you and your senior lead(s) achieve all key deadlines
- Maintain an effective filing and document control system
- Coordinate the creation and production of board reports, management meeting reports and other ad hoc reports as required
- Take and/or coordinate the production of accurate minutes and action trackers/lists when required, circulate in a timely manner and produce agenda's for meetings
- Become familiar with policies, procedures and relevant administrative systems e.g. finance, HR and where necessary
- Undertake elements of financial administration such as raising purchase orders, collating invoices, and setting up new suppliers. Liaising with the finance team as appropriate support the timely authorisation of approvals
- Commissioning the creation and delivery of internal and external business messaging and communications on behalf of your senior lead in collaboration with the communications team
- Commissioning the creation and development of marketing materials required by the business
